ENGLISH Bluetooth operations General • While driving, do not perform complicated operation such as dialing the numbers, using phone book, etc. When you perform these operations, stop your car in a safe place. • Some Bluetooth devices may not be connected to this unit depending on the Bluetooth version of the device. • This unit may not work for some Bluetooth devices. • Connecting condition may vary depending on circumstances around you. • When the unit is turned off, the device is disconnected. Warning messages for Bluetooth operations Connection Error: The device is registered but the connection has failed. Use / to connect the device again. (☞ page 31) Error: Try the operation again. If "Error" appears again, check if the device supports the function you have tried. Please Wait...: The unit is preparing to use the Bluetooth function. If the message does not disappear, turn off and turn on the unit, then connect the device again (or reset the unit). Icons for phone types • These icons indicate the phone type set on the device. Cellular phone Household phone Office General Other than above iPod/iPhone operations • You can control the following types of iPods/iPhones: (A) Connected with the USB cable: - iPod with video (5th Generation)*1 - iPod classic*1 - iPod nano - iPod nano (2nd Generation) - iPod nano (3rd Generation)*1 - iPod nano (4th Generation)*1 - iPod Touch*1 - iPod Touch (2nd Generation)*1 - iPhone/iPhone 3G*1 (B) Connected with the interface adapter: - iPod with Click Wheel (4th Generation) - iPod with video (5th Generation) - iPod classic - iPod mini - iPod photo - iPod nano - iPod nano (2nd Generation) - iPod nano (3rd Generation) - iPod nano (4th Generation)*2 *1 To watch the video with its audio, connect the iPod/iPhone using USB Audio and Video cable (not supplied). *2 It is not possible to charge the battery through this unit. • If the iPod/iPhone does not play correctly, update your iPod/iPhone software to the latest version. For details about updating your iPod/iPhone, visit . • When you turn on this unit, the iPod/iPhone is charged through the unit. • While the iPod/iPhone is connected, all operations from the iPod/iPhone are disable. Perform all operations from this unit. • The text information may not be displayed correctly. • The text information scrolls on the monitor. This unit can display up to 40 characters when using the interface adapter and up to 128 characters when using the USB 2.0 cable or USB Audio and Video cable. 62
